Guiria vs Tarfaya Climate & Distance Between

Morocco flag
  • The distance between Guiria, Venezuela and Tarfaya, Morocco is approximately 5,481 km or 3,406 mi.
  • To reach Guiria in this distance one would set out from Tarfaya bearing 259.5° or W and follow the great circles arc to approach Guiria bearing 242.1° or WSW .
  • Guiria has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Tarfaya has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• The annual average temperature is 7.8 °C (14°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.1 °C (5.6°F) less in Guiria.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 889 mm (35 in) more which is equivalent to 889 l/m² (21.82 US gal/ft²) or 8,890,000 l/ha (950,400 US gal/ac) more. About 18 5/6 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 11.4° higher in Guiria than in Tarfaya.
  • Relative humidity levels are 2.5%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 8.1°C (14.5°F) higher.
